Base64 php pdf tutorials

In the series of how to add impression to server from android, i will exhibit how to change the graphic to base64 to send out to php mysql databases server. Remove that data in the function before decoding the string, like so. For work with base64 encoder in android need to add import java import android. Mime encoding of a pdf file in an html page stack overflow. Best way to display a pdf from base64string in telerik. This example is how to turn an image into a base64 string i. Base64 is the encryption format used by browsers when implementing very simple username and password form of basic authentication. The decimal values obtained are converted into their binary equivalents. This article explains how it all works, and shows some different ways of converting back and forth between original and encoded images. Python implements images base64 encode for beginners python. Convert base64 to image file and write to folder in php with. Base64 decoding is the opposite of base64 encoding. Javascript base64 javascript tutorial with example source code. Uploading pdf files as base64 strings in php and saving it in the.

Calculates the base64 representation of a string or binary object. Php how to convert pdf to base64 or base64 to pdf using php. A link to click on that downloads this document as an pdf. Ive been following a few tutorials to create my own mail function.

The base64 format uses printable characters, allowing binary data to be sent in forms and email, and stored in a database or file. As of this writing, documented classes suitable for production use are available from which you can compile encoder and decoder objects. This class contain methods for encoding and decoding the base64 representation of binary data. This encoding is designed to make binary data survive transport through transport layers that are not 8bit clean, such as mail bodies. How to encode decode data in android android development. Word 2016 tutorial complete for professionals and students. Hi keith,i have a requirement to attach word file in the pdf and display the contents of the file in the text field on the form. So, the steps of base64 decoding can be described as follows. If you ask anyone these days, however, for a serious point of view on using it, youll likely get laughed at.

A basic example of how to convert base64 string to pdf in php. How to convert an html element or document into image. This strategy is good for microsoft word, acrobat pdf, jpg image and so on even. Full sample of how to load a pdf from a base64 string. This will result in invalid image data when the base64 function decodes it. I have saved in database its url but as per api requirement i need to encode the pdf file itself in base 64 format. Php get pdf file from base64 encoded data string stack. Convert base64 to pdf in php examples php developers. Nov 19, 2017 uploading files or images from mobile app is a most common case in many projects, there are two ways to finish this task, one of them is most popular, much safer, and considering as a best. While working with canvas, you will have base64 encoded string in the form, then you will send the form data to the server using post method and on the server, you convert them into an image file.

In other words, it is carried out by reversing the steps described in the previous section. Function to save base64 image to png with php github. Convert a base64 string in a blob according to the data and contenttype. Php get pdf file from base64 encoded data string stack overflow.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. How to save a pdf from a base64 string on the device with cordova. The base64 representation of a string or binary object. Save base64 encoded image to file using php tricks of it. Nov 16, 2010 not a php programmer, but surely you have to fopen the file in binary mode. Resolved base64 mime corrupt attachments phpbuilder forums. Javascript experiments actionscript tutorials css php javascript base64 license this javascript code is used to encode decode data using base64 this encoding is designed to make binary data survive transport through transport layers that are not 8bit clean. Base64 is a way in which 8bit binary data is encoded into a format that.

Uploading files or images from mobile app is a most common case in many projects, there are two ways to finish this task, one of them is most popular, much safer, and considering as a best. This strategy is good for microsoft word, acrobat pdf, jpg image and so on even zipped files. Now i dont know which way is the best to display the pdf on mobile devices or which ways are possible. Hello, i recieve a pdf from a webservice as a base64 string. Aug 09, 2019 how to convert pdf file to base64 encode using php. How to upload blob image to mysql database using php, sql. The php base64 encode algorithm can return a string with the character in that string. Uploading images to a folder and saving its path in mysql database. Now in the directive we accept only the pdfs url, but this feature will be considered in future releases, so the user can pass a base64 string instead of the url.

How to convert pdf file to base64 encode using php. Apr 07, 2015 really simple way do it use base64 encoder, which has adding to android sdk since api 8. For those involved in the securing of websites, understanding how these functions are used to encode and decode encrypted chunks of php data is critical to. If you do not specify the b flag when working with binary files, you may experience strange problems with your data, including broken image files and strange problems with \r characters. This video will show you, how to convert pdf to base64 or base64 to pdf using. In php, its very easy to get image file from base64 encoded. If youre reading this post, chances are youre having some issues when trying to upload. It seems to be sent correctly, but the pdf file is corrupt. Base64encoded data takes about 33% more space than the original data. Feel free to use our online tools to decode or encode your data.

Well organized and easy to understand web building tutorials with lots of examples of how to use html, css, javascript, sql, php, python, bootstrap, java. Learn more mime encoding of a pdf file in an html page. In order to convert an image into base64 encoding firstly need to get the contents of file. If youre want to know how base64 format works, please visit our explanation page for decode or encode. Each character in the string is changed to its base64 decimal value. In order to write the pdf base64 string as a file on the device, well use the following two methods. Nov 17, 2019 read image data to implement base64 encode. Uploading and inserting image in mysql database in a blob column. If you need to work with base64 format, then this site is built for you. While this article shows how to properly call the php base64 encode and decode functions, the basic premise of removing the characters from the url, as discussed next, is not correct. Learn python with our complete python tutorial guide, whether youre. While this article shows how to properly call the php base64 encode and decode functions, the basic.

604 1551 666 1427 1590 58 612 258 439 1405 1014 541 1190 111 1177 511 455 771 1178 1259 59 422 1492 503 738 505 78 1276 906 58 720 1571 1067 1056 749 372 846 1130 17 1278 632 472 115 786 156